At first, we gathered just to mourn,
Our own griefs our own way,
But we've come beside each other;
Built friendships that will stay.
We're made closer in the sorrows,
On our shoulders, carried.
We're learning how to live again,
Despite all which we've buried.
We're comforted by spoken truths
And stories told through tears.
We bear one another's burdens
And ease each other's fears.
As per the cord and the power source,
We, too, must be plugged in.
Connected, one to another,
For strength to flow within.
My heart is thankful for you all,
My mentors and my friends.
We'll always have this time we've shared;
Our memories won't end.
